Technical Specifications
Side-by-side comparison of Core i5-4570TE and A10-6790K

Core i5-4570TE
The Core i5-4570TE is manufactured by Intel. It was released in 2 June 2013 (12 years ago). It is based on the Haswell (2013−2015) architecture. It features 2 cores and 4 threads. Base frequency is 2.7 GHz, with boost up to 3.3 GHz. L3 cache: 4096 kB (total). L2 cache: 256 kB (per core). Built on 22 nm process technology. Socket: LGA1150. Thermal design power (TDP): 35 Watt. Memory support: DDR3. Passmark benchmark score: 3,085 points. Launch price was $239.

A10-6790K
The A10-6790K is manufactured by AMD. It was released in 2014-01-01. It is based on the Richland (2013−2014) architecture. It features 4 cores and 4 threads. Base frequency is 4 GHz, with boost up to 4.3 GHz. L3 cache: 0 kB. L2 cache: 4096 kB. Built on 32 nm process technology. Socket: FM2. Thermal design power (TDP): 100 Watt. Memory support: DDR3-1866. Passmark benchmark score: 3,112 points. Launch price was $130.
Processing Power
The Core i5-4570TE packs 2 cores / 4 threads, while the A10-6790K offers 4 cores / 4 threads — the A10-6790K has 2 more cores. Boost clocks reach 3.3 GHz on the Core i5-4570TE versus 4.3 GHz on the A10-6790K — a 26.3% clock advantage for the A10-6790K (base: 2.7 GHz vs 4 GHz). The Core i5-4570TE uses the Haswell (2013−2015) architecture (22 nm), while the A10-6790K uses Richland (2013−2014) (32 nm). In PassMark, the Core i5-4570TE scores 3,085 against the A10-6790K's 3,112 — a 0.9% lead for the A10-6790K. Geekbench 6 single-core — the metric most relevant to gaming — records 966 vs 412, a 80.4% lead for the Core i5-4570TE that directly translates to higher frame rates. L3 cache: 4096 kB (total) on the Core i5-4570TE vs 0 kB on the A10-6790K.

Memory & Platform
The Core i5-4570TE uses the LGA1150 socket (PCIe 3.0), while the A10-6790K uses FM2 (PCIe 3.0) — making them incompatible on the same motherboard. Both support up to DDR3-1600 memory speed. Both support up to 32 GB of RAM. Both feature 2-channel memory with ECC support. Both provide 16 PCIe lanes. Chipset compatibility: H81,B85,H87,Q87,Z87,Q85,C226,H97,Z97 (Core i5-4570TE) and A55,A58,A68H,A75,A78,A85X,A88X (A10-6790K).

Advanced Features
Only the A10-6790K has an unlocked multiplier for overclocking — a significant advantage for enthusiasts seeking extra performance. Virtualization support: VT-x, VT-d, EPT (Core i5-4570TE) vs AMD-V (A10-6790K). Both include integrated graphics — HD Graphics 4600 (Core i5-4570TE) and Radeon HD 8670D (A10-6790K) — useful as a fallback for troubleshooting or display output without a dedicated GPU. Primary use case: Core i5-4570TE targets Embedded, A10-6790K targets Budget. Direct competitor: Core i5-4570TE rivals Embedded R-Series; A10-6790K rivals Core i3-4340.
